The Garni Temple is the centerpiece of this tour, recognized as the only standing Greco-Roman colonnaded building in Armenia and the former Soviet Union. Located in the village of Garni, it serves as a symbol of pre-Christian Armenia and attracts visitors interested in ancient architecture.
An Ionic pagan temple, the Garni Temple’s architecture reveals classical design influences, making it a striking sight. Visitors can marvel at the well-preserved columns and structural details that reflect the grandeur of the period.
